For Unicorn No-Bake Strawberry Split Cake

To make this delicious cake, you will need the following ingredients, bursting with color and flavor:

  • 2 cups graham cracker crumbs – the base of our treasure trove, providing a crunchy texture.
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ted – for that rich buttery flavor that binds the crust.
  • 16 oz cream cheese, softened – bringing in creaminess and a velvety texture.
  • 1 cup powdered sugar – adding delightful sweetness to the filling.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ract – infusing warmth and depth of flavor.
  • 2 cups whipped cream – light and fluffy, making every bite dreamy.
  • 1 cup diced strawberries – for juicy bursts of fruity flavor.
  • Pink food coloring – to achieve that enchanting unicorn hue.
  • 1 cup whipped cream (for topping) – an extra dollop of lightness.
  • Fresh strawberries (for topping) – adding a fresh and fruity splash.
  • Sprinkles (for topping) – for added fun and a pop of color.
  • Edible glitter (for topping) – making it truly magical.

Step-by-Step Directions

Creating your Unicorn No-Bake Strawberry Split Cake is as easy as 1-2-3! Here’s how you can bring this delightful dessert to life:

  1. Prepare the crust: In a mixing b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s with the melted butter. Mix until it’s well combined and the texture resembles wet sand. Press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ish to create a solid crust. Once complete, place this dish in the refrigerator to set while you work on the filling.

  2. Make the filling: In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until it’s smooth and creamy. Gradually add in the powdered sugar and vanilla extract, mixing until the ingredients are well combined. Look for a lovely creamy consistency.

  3. Fold in the whipped cream: Gently fold in the whipped cream with a spatula until it’s fully integrated with the cream cheese mixture, ensuring a light and airy texture. Drop in a few drops of pink food coloring, and mix until you achieve your desired shade.

  4. Incorporate strawberries: Carefully stir in the diced strawberries. Once they’re evenly distributed in the mixture, pour the filling over the prepared graham cracker crust, smoothing the top with a spatula until it’s nice and even.

  5. Chill the cake: Cover your baking dish with plastic wrap or foil and refrigerate for at least four hours or until the filling is fully set. This step is crucial; the cooling will help solidify the layers.

  6. Add the whipped cream topping: When you’re ready to serve, remove the cake from the fridge. Spread an additional layer of whipped cream over the top for an added touch of decadence.

  7. Decorate the cake: Get creative! Top the cake with fresh strawberries, colorful sprinkles, and a sprinkle of edible glitter to make your unicorn cake come alive.

  8. Serve and enjoy: Slice your cake into squares, serve it on a bright plate, and watch as faces light up with joy as they take their first bites of this whimsical treat!

Tips & Tricks

To elevate your Unicorn No-Bake Strawberry Split Cake, consider some of these expert tips:

  • Whip it Right: Make sure your cream cheese is at room temperature to easily blend everything together without lumps. Enjoy a smoother filling!

  • Color Play: Feel free to add some blue or purple food coloring along with the pink to create a multi-colored effect, transforming your cake into a swirling masterpiece.

  • Flavor Burst: Mix in other fruits like blueberries or raspberries for added flavor and a delightful twist on your cake. A combination can create a magnificent rainbow effect!

  • Freeze for Later: If you have leftovers, you can freeze the cake for up to a month. Simply wrap it well in plastic wrap and store it in an airtight container.

Storing Tips & Variations for Unicorn No-Bake Strawberry Split Cake

To store your delightful creation, keep it in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. You can also freeze the cake by slicing it first; wrap each slice in plastic wrap and aluminum foil. Simply thaw individual slices when you’re ready to indulge again!

For a healthier twist, consider using Greek yogurt instead of cream cheese for a lighter filling, or swap out some of the sugar with a natural sweetener. You can also experiment with different flavorings in the filling, such as almond or coconut extract, to create variations.

FAQs

1. Can I make this dessert ahead of time?
Absolutely! The cake sets well in the refrigerator and can be made one or two days in advance. Just keep it covered.

2. Can I use frozen strawberries instead of fresh?
Yes, frozen strawberries can be used. Just thaw and drain them before adding to the filling to avoid excess moisture.

3. What can I substitute for graham cracker crumbs?
You can use crushed digestive biscuits or even Oreos for a chocolate version of the crust.

4. How long does this cake last in the fridge?
Stored properly, the cake can last about 5 days in the refrigerator.

5. Can I use a different flavor of fruit?
Definitely! Feel free to incorporate other fruits such as blueberries, raspberries, or bananas to give your cake a different flavor profile.
